0

我正在努力了解何时应该创建一个新控制器。

假设我有一个维护人员记录(姓名、年龄等)的应用程序

我有几点看法。显示人员列表的视图,我可以选择显示。显示详细人员信息的视图(仅查看) 编辑人员记录的视图 添加人员记录的视图(在 MVC 中,添加和编辑通常是一个视图吗?)

目前,我有一个控制器。但这是对的,还是每个视图都应该有一个控制器?我担心我的单个控制器变得太大...

4

1 回答 1

1

最好为每个资源(在您的情况下为人)设置一个控制器,而不是为每个视图设置一个控制器。因此,PersonsController处理人员列表、人员详细信息和编辑人员是正确的。

于 2012-09-17T05:18:22.460 回答